From the Bride

We met on Facebook Dating.We had a very casual first date, we watched a hockey game and had pizza. Chris proposed on Valentine’s Day of this year. We like to be outdoors and hike and occasionally look for geo caches. We purchased a house together last fall and I wanted to try a new hiking trail not far from our house. So on Valentine’s Day just as it started to snow Chris suggested we go check it out. When we got there he said let’s see if there are any geo caches and there was! He was reading the clues and I was leading the way. I found the can and took it down. There was a sweet note inside from Chris and then he dropped down on one knee and proposed in the woods with the snow falling like a snow globe. I was completely surprised! How neat is it to now get married in the woods!

We wanted to elope and enjoy the outdoors and mountains. We have never been to TN but found Chapel in the Hollow and thought it would be perfect for our wedding.  We are looking forward to an intimate ceremony tucked away in the woods.

We like the outdoors. We like to fish (both summer and ice fish.) Chris likes to hunt as well. We enjoy sports and music. We enjoy spending time with our kids (5 between the two of us- all of them in their 20s) and our family. But we also value quiet nights at home just the two of us as well.
